What is Electrical Inspection?

An expert evaluation of your house's whole electrical system is called a home electrical inspection.

The main electrical panel, GFCI outlets, and wiring are among the crucial components of the property's electrical system that a home inspector will examine.

The inspector will make sure that everything looks to be wired correctly and that all outlets, fixtures, and appliances are operational.

1. Routine Electrical Inspection

A regular electrical inspection, commonly referred to as a periodic electrical inspection, is a thorough evaluation of the electrical system in your house carried out to find any possible safety risks and make sure everything is operating as it should.

The following is an outline of what is usually involved in a routine electrical inspection:

  • Early problem identification
  • Comfort
  • Maintaining functionality

When doing a routine electrical inspection, the inspector looks for:

  • Visual Inspection: To look for any indications of damage, corrosion, or loose connections, inspectors will carefully inspect electrical panels, outlets, switches, and wiring.
  • Grounding Verification: For safety, proper grounding is necessary. To guard against electrical shocks, the inspector will make sure that all outlets and appliances are correctly grounded.
  • Circuit Functionality: To make sure different circuits are operating appropriately and aren't overloaded, they could test them.
  • Smoke and Carbon Monoxide Detectors: Although not technically a component of the electrical system, some inspectors may examine the existence and correct operation of these essential devices for gas leak and fire safety.

2. Pre-Purchase Electrical Inspection

When contemplating a home purchase, a pre-purchase electrical check is an essential stage.

Before you complete the purchase, an experienced and licensed electrician will do a thorough inspection of the property's electrical system.

A pre-purchase electrical check is crucial for the following reasons:

  • Exposing Possible Safety Risks
  • Making an Informed Purchase
  • Steer clear of costly surprises

What is covered by the pre-purchase inspection:

  • Detailed Inspection: The electrical panel, wiring, switches, outlets, and grounding systems will all be carefully inspected by the electrician.
  • Verification of Safety Features: They will make sure that, even though they are not a part of the electrical system, carbon monoxide and smoke detectors are there and operating correctly.
  • Ability Assessment: Especially if you want to utilize high-powered equipment, the inspector will determine if the electrical service panel has the ability to meet the present and future electrical demands of the home.

3. Post-Installation Electrical Inspection

A thorough examination of an electrical system carried out following the completion of rewiring or the installation of new electrical components is known as a post-installation electrical inspection.

Before depending on the new electrical components, it is imperative to make sure the electrical work is completed correctly, complies with safety regulations, and operates effectively.

The reasons this inspection is so important:

  • Verification of Safe and Correct Installation
  • Building Code Compliance: To guarantee that safety requirements are fulfilled, electrical systems must abide by local building regulations.

What activities are involved in this inspection:

  • Visual Inspection: The freshly installed electrical panels, outlets, switches, and wiring (if accessible) will all be carefully inspected by the inspector.
  • Functionality Testing: To make sure the new outlets, switches, and circuits operate properly and are not overloaded, they will test their functionality.
  • Verification of Grounding: For safety, proper grounding is necessary.

2. Inspections of industrial electrical systems

  • Focus: The electrical systems in factories, manufacturing plants, and other industrial facilities are the main focus of these examinations.
  • What the inspector looks for: Large electrical panels, control systems, grounding systems for machinery, heavy-duty transformers, and arc flash (electrical explosion) protection measures are all things that inspectors keep a close eye on.

3. Inspections of Commercial Electrical Systems

  • Focus: The electrical systems of commercial buildings, such as offices, shops, and restaurants, are the subject of these examinations.
  • The Inspector Searches for Inspectors to check for compliance with fire safety rules, confirm correct wiring for commercial lighting systems, test emergency generators and backup power systems, and guarantee sufficient capacity for high-power equipment.

4. Inspections of Arc Fault Circuit Interrupters (AFCIs)

  • Focus: The purpose of these inspections is to evaluate the performance of AFCI circuit breakers, which are sophisticated breakers intended to identify and stop electrical sparks that have the potential to start fires.
  • What the Examiner Searches for: Using specialized instruments to mimic arc faults, the inspector examines AFCI breakers and confirms they trip appropriately to avert possible fires.

Signs That Indicate the Need for a House Electrical Inspection

To guarantee the security and efficiency of your electrical system, there are a number of warning indications that point to the necessity of a home electrical inspection. In fact, this checklist is a home electrical safety check.

Here are a few crucial ones to be aware of:

Problems with Lighting

Lights that flicker or dim might indicate a breaker that is malfunctioning, weak wiring, or overloaded circuits.

It's a good idea to contact an electrician if your lights constantly flicker or dim, especially when you turn on appliances.

Burning odors near light switches or outlets is a major warning sign that may point to electrical arcing or overheated wires, both of which can be fire hazards.

Issues with outlets and switches

When you plug in or turn on appliances and notice sparks emanating from the outlets or switches, this is a warning indication and has to be attended to right away by a licensed electrician.

To the touch, electrical switches and outlets shouldn't ever feel warm. If switches or outlets feel hot to the touch, there may be a fire hazard due to overloaded circuits or unsecured wiring.

An electrician must fix any outlets or switches that feel loose in their sockets when you put anything in or turn them on. This poses a safety risk. Arcing and overheating can result from loose connections.

Older homes often have two-prong plugs without grounding prongs. These outlets should be replaced by a licensed electrician with three-pronged grounded outlets as they don't adhere to modern safety regulations.

Additional red flags:

  • Visible Damage to Electrical Components: It's critical to contact an electrician for an examination and repairs if you see any visible damage to your electrical panel, outlets, switches, or cables (such as cracks, scorch marks, or exposed wiring).
  • When you touch an appliance and get a tingling sensation, there may be a risk of electrical shock.
  • Unexplained Burning Odors: Although the burning smell may not be emanating from an electrical component specifically, it may be an indication of electrical problems leading to overheating in appliances or walls.

Examining the electrical panel

  • Check for the existence and proper operation of the main disconnect switch, which enables you to turn off the entire house's electricity in an emergency.
  • Panel State: Look for indications of damage, rust, corrosion, or overheating on the electrical panel.
  • Breaker Capacity: Verify that the primary breaker's amperage rating and the panel's overall capacity are sufficient to handle the house's present and future electrical needs.
  • Labeling: Ensure that the panel's circuits are all clearly labeled so that it is simple to determine which breaker operates which outlets and appliances.

Branch Wiring and Circuits

  • Type and Condition of wire: Visually check all of the accessible wires in the home for indications of wear and tear, fraying, overheating, or mismatching in size to the circuits it serves.
  • If your house contains aluminum wiring, the inspector should mention it and offer advice on any possible safety issues or suggested preventative measures.
  • Check for the existence and operation of ground fault circuit interrupters (GFCIs) and arc fault circuit interrupters (AFCIs) in garages, restrooms, kitchens, and outdoor outlets.
  • Circuits: Locate any circuits that may be overloaded as a result of having too many appliances plugged in or being used beyond what is recommended.

Switches and Outlets

  • Type of Outlet: Verify that every outlet satisfies current safety regulations by being a three-prong grounded outlet.
  • Condition of Outlet: Check outlets for burn marks, loose plugs, or damage.
  • Functionality of switches: Check that all switches work properly and turn on and off lights and appliances.

Factors Influencing Electrical Home Inspection Costs

There are a number of variables that might affect how much an electrical house inspection costs.

Below is a summary of some significant influences:

  • The size of the house
  • Age of the house: Because of possible degradation or obsolete components, older homes (those built beyond 25 years of age) may need more thorough assessments for their electrical systems.
  • Simple systems: Because they take less time and effort to verify, homes with simple electrical configurations may have cheaper inspection expenses.
  • Complex systems: It probably takes more time and knowledge to thoroughly check a home with features like solar panels, built-in appliances, pools, or hot tubs.
  • Cost of living: Higher labor costs for electricians are typically associated with higher cost of living areas, and this might be reflected in the inspection fee.
  • Standard inspection: The essential parts of your home's electrical system are usually examined during a regular electrical inspection.
  • Inspections with a specialty: Due to the specialist expertise and equipment needed, inspections concentrating on certain electrical systems, such as solar panels, pools, or AFCI/GFCI performance, may be more expensive.

What is the difference between inspection and testing electrical?

Inspection is a visual examination of the electrical equipment or installation to check for any defects, damage, or compliance with safety standards.

Testing, on the other hand, involves the use of specialized equipment to measure and evaluate the performance of the electrical system.

Who does electrical inspection in Toronto?

The Electrical Safety Authority (ESA) is largely responsible for conducting electrical inspections in Toronto. Their duty is to guarantee that electrical installations adhere to the Ontario Electrical Safety Code.

When do I need a home electrical safety inspection?

Although it's advisable to get one done sooner for your safety, the basic rule of thumb is to never wait more than ten years to get another one.

In addition, you should complete one if you're buying or selling a house, among other reasons. Also, if you are aware that you have an electrical issue.

How do I check for electrical problems in my house?

Common indicators include lights that flicker or fade, circuit breakers that trip regularly, outlets or switches that feel warm, strange buzzing or humming noises, and burning odors.

Is electrical inspection different from home inspection and building inspection?

An electrical inspection of a house usually includes examining the wiring, outlets, switches, and circuit breakers as well as the overall state of the electrical system.

A building inspection might include a more thorough electrical examination that includes checking that the electrical system complies with building laws and regulations as well as going over the electrical plans and specifications.

What is the difference between electrical inspection in residential and commercial Inspections?

The safety and efficiency of the electrical systems in single-family houses are the main concerns of residential electrical inspections.

Compared to commercial inspections, which focus on bigger, more sophisticated systems in structures like offices, factories, or retail stores, they are often less complicated.
